Posted by SunsetLtd (Member # 3985) on :
 
Maybe its the directional running that UP does. They make the eastbound Sunset use a different route than the westbound and it requires a backup move out of houston to reach the alternate route. I don't know if they are still doing this but that could explain why #2 always losses about an hour between Houston and Beaumont. And the other half hour is just normal UP dispatching.
